Almond Flour This serves as our grain-free, low-carb base. It provides a naturally sweet, nutty undertone and creates a wonderfully tender, cake-like crumb structure.
Cottage Cheese The secret star of the show for ultimate moisture and structure. It melts completely into the batter during baking, boosting the protein content significantly without adding heavy oils.
Banana Extract (or a small amount of real overripe banana) Provides that unmistakable, comforting banana flavor. Pairing a touch of real fruit with high-quality extract keeps the carb count perfectly low-carb compliant.
Granulated Sweetener (Erythritol/Monk Fruit Blend) Gives the bread its classic, sweet finish. It dissolves smoothly into the wet ingredients without leaving any bitter or cooling aftertaste.
Eggs Act as the essential binding agent and leavening support. They help the grain-free flours rise beautifully in the oven, ensuring a light, uniform loaf.
Keep your leftover slices stored in an airtight container placed in the refrigerator, where the bread will stay remarkably fresh, moist, and delicious for up to 5 days. For longer storage, wrap individual slices securely in plastic wrap, place them into a heavy-duty freezer bag, and freeze for up to 3 months. When a craving hits, simply pop a frozen slice directly into the toaster or oven for a few minutes to restore that fresh-baked warmth.
